    Hearing Limini is out for the NH season and is likely to either run on the flat in the summer (Ebor is an option) or be retired to the breeding sheds. Been a tough couple of years for Rich Ricci with the death of Vatour, Annie Power retiring, Douvan out for an extended period and Faugheens problems as well as losing a 6 figure purchase in an acciddnt on the gallops.

    Arctic Fire has also been retired.

    Thunder Snow wins the Dubai World Cup comfortably. Top race in terms of prize money, but doesn't have anything like the prestige as the top races in Europe or the US. Funny, I remember Thunder Snow when he was racing over here. He was beaten out of sight by Carravagio as a two year old at Royal Ascot, and I thought O'Brien would train Carravagio for mile/mile and a quarter races after that performance, where he was clearly staying on at the end, instead of which he trained him as a sprinter and the season finished as a damp squib and he was retired to stud.
